Object Detection and Segmentation for Autonomous Vehicles
This project involved annotating a large-scale dataset of images and videos for a leading autonomous vehicle company. My tasks included drawing bounding boxes around vehicles, pedestrians, and traffic signs, as well as performing pixel-level segmentation for road and lane detection. I also tracked objects across video frames to ensure consistency in motion analysis. The dataset consisted of over 100,000 images and 5,000 video clips, and I adhered to strict quality control measures, including regular peer reviews and accuracy checks. My work directly contributed to the training of AI models for self-driving car navigation and safety systems.
